Announcing McKay Tract Coalition Community Gathering - Jan 30, 6pm
In a week from today on Friday, Jan 30, 2009, there will be a community meeting of the McKay Tract Coalition to discuss ways of organizing, uniting, and educating ourselves in order to effectively protect this rare and ancient forest spanning 7000 acres and home to so many animals.
We need your help and support to stop this destruction and protect this land once and for all.
Location and Time:
Humboldt State University | Nelson Hall | Room 106
at 6pm

Earth First! Humboldt Announces Action Camp
Upcoming Action Camp was recently announced by the newly formed Earth First! Humboldt movement located in Humboldt County, California.
The Action Camp will be 8 days [ September 5 - 13 ] of training, seminars, skill-shares, communal eating, fun & games, and, of course, ACTIONS!
Scheduled Trainings:
- Non-Violence Direct Action (NDVA)
- Tree Climbing
- Know Your Rights (What to do when you get arrested)
- Backwoods
